Ryszard Prauss (1902-1955) - Set of 3 pencil drawings29 x 20 cm passe-partout, framed in identical silver frames 40 x 31 cm1.Lancer on horseback, 2.Study of a horse, 3.Sitting lancer with horseRyszard Prauss studied 1924-1930 in the studios of Mieczyslaw Kotarbinski and Tadeusz Pruszkowski at the Warsaw Academy of Fine Arts. At the same time he studied printmaking with well-known professors: Władysław Skoczylas and Edmund Bartłomiejczyk. Ryszard Prauss is a traditional painter and draftsman, specializing mainly in pencil and crayon. His favorite subjects are mainly Polish reconstructed architecture.
